Numerous people have inquired about accessing past IBIS Summit
presentations.  These have been available on the IBIS web site, but
specific titles could be found only by manual searches through
individual subdirectories.  As a result, a considerable archive of
technical materials has been effectively unavailable to the IBIS and SI
communities, until now.

The IBIS Open Forum has just posted comprehensive indices of all Summit
presentations from 1993 through today.  These indices are available at:

        http://www.eda.org/pub/ibis/summits/

The Summit file listings may be sorted by title, date delivered, author
or presenting organization.  Many of the presentations are available in
multiple formats.  Over 250 titles on topics ranging from accuracy to
XML are in the archive now, with additional titles to be added after
each future summit.
